Restarting the unit after
the temperature sensors
are triggered
L
There are temperature sensors located in the exhaust ducts which measure the tempera-
ture of the fumes extracted. If the temperature in the exhaust duct exceeds +60 °C – when
an open flame is sucked in, for example – the temperature sensors are triggered for safety
reasons. This immediately switches off extraction and the connected induction hob, cooking
and heat-retaining units to prevent serious damage to the unit. The words "Temperature
alarm" will be displayed on the B.PRO Control control electronics to indicate the unit is swit-
ched off.
The unit cannot be restarted until after a suitable cool-down time (up to 30 minutes).
– After the unit cools down, the B.PRO Control control electronics must be reset by switching
them off and then on again.
– Then carry out a visual inspection of all filters, the extraction bridge, the exhaust duct, the
odour filter box and the fans for any damage, ashes or combustion residues.
Warning!
Injury from jet flames
If grease in the grease collecting channel or the filter cassettes has caught fire, a flash flame may
erupt from this smouldering fire due to the sudden supply of oxygen.
– Carefully remove lid of extraction bridge.
– Inspect the interior of the extraction bridge for ashes and combustion residues, clean and
reinsert.

– Check exhaust ducts for ashes and combustion residues and clean them.
– Remove top surface from the odour filter box and dismantle fan.
– Remove optional ION TEC filter from the odour filter box and check for damage and scorch
marks.

– Change the filters if necessary.
– Remove fan and check for ashes and combustion residues.
– If necessary, have fans cleaned by an authorised service point.

– Re-insert optional ION TEC filter into its designated position in the odour filter box.

– Check charcoal filter pad for impurities and replace if necessary.
– Clean odour filter box.
– Reattach cover to odour filter box.
– Return the unit to operation.
